A Barker resident. Hugh M.
Benton, died today (March 26,
1968) at the age of 83.
Born in Richland Center, Wis.
in 1883, he was the son of Robert
and Sarah Morrow Benton.
He has been a resident of
Barker for many years, and
was employed by Harrison Radiator
Division of General Mo
tors Corp. until his retirement.
He is survived by his widow,
Mary Paul Benton: one daughter,
Sarah W Benton of Rosemont.
Pa.: four sons, Robert H.
Benton of Barker, the Rev.
Benson A Benton of Sanborn,
R. Paul Benton of North Tona-,
wanda. and John T Benton of
Lockport. He was the father of
the late William Benton of
Springfield, Ill. He is also sur-
vived by 14 grandchildren.
Friends may call today from
7 to 9 p.m. t t the Hood Funeral
Home in Barker, and tomorrow
from 2 to 5 and 7 to 9. Services
will be held Monday at 2 p.m.
with the Rev. Mendel Danningburg
officiating. Burial will be
in Hartland Central Cemetery
